Description

The vCenter Server contains an SSRF (Server Side Request Forgery) vulnerability due to improper validation of URLs in vCenter Server Content Library. An authorised user with access to content library may exploit this issue by sending a POST request to vCenter Server leading to information disclosure.

Affected Software

VendorProductVersions
VmwareCloud Foundation>= 3.0, < 5.0
VmwareVcenter Server6.5
VmwareVcenter Server6.7
VmwareVcenter Server7.0
